The United States is close to reaching another vaccine milestone. Yesterday, President Biden said almost 200 million vaccines have been administered since he took office. He also called on businesses to give their employees paid time off to get vaccinated and announced a new tax credit to fully offset the cost for small businesses and nonprofits.
